Just came back from Singapore yesterday.. visited some friends and ex-colleagues-turned friends.. been a while since I've meet some of them.. the last time I saw them was 2009, which was more than 3 years ago..

Stayed in a backpackers' hostel, for SG$40 a night in a single dorm room.. it was located between Boon Keng MRT and Farrer Park MRT with access to lots of buses too.. I didn't want to spend $$ on fancy hotel rooms as I just needed a place to sleep.. also I didn't want to trouble any of my friends..

Lots have changed since I last visited.. more buildings.. more shopping malls.. more condominiums.. more cars.. more MRT stations.. more on-going constructions.. a lot of 'hardware' has been and is going to be build, yet the 'software' is still very much lacking.. the service quality still sucks (compared to TW and JP).. the level of civic-mindedness still left much to be desired.. the 'kiasu-ness' is still the norm.. the rat-race still leaves most stressed-out and burnt-out.. Infrastructurally, SG is still a good place to live, but unless one belongs to the wealthy or well-to-do, there is no way one can slow-down and enjoy all the new amenities this island city has to offer.. Personally, SG has become way too 'crowded' for my liking..
